In Tennessee, you'll find a mix of housing styles, from historic homes in older neighborhoods to newer constructions. This means your garage door bottom seal might be dealing with uneven concrete or slightly warped thresholds. The frequent temperature swings, from hot, sticky summers to chilly winters, can also cause seals to become brittle or crack over time, letting in more than just air. When thinking about replacing your garage door bottom seal, consider how much debris and moisture it needs to keep out. Are you seeing water pooling after a heavy rain in Murfreesboro, or dust bunnies accumulating on a windy day? These are clear signs it's time for a change.

What is the average life of a garage door spring?

The average life of a garage door spring can vary, but typically they last between 7 to 15 years. Factors like usage, the weight of the door, and environmental conditions in Tennessee can influence this. Regular maintenance can help extend their lifespan, but replacement is sometimes necessary.

How do I know if my garage door bottom seal needs replacing?

Look for visible gaps, cracks, or signs of wear on your current seal. If you notice drafts, water, or pests entering your garage in Tennessee, it's a strong indicator. In Murfreesboro, where humidity is common, a worn seal can lead to moisture damage. A quick inspection can tell you if it's time for a replacement.
